Understanding the Parent Breeds

Yorkshire Terrier

The Yorkshire Terrier, often referred to as the Yorkie, is a small breed of dog that originated in the United Kingdom. Known for their long, silky hair and petite size, Yorkies are popular for their lively and affectionate nature. They are intelligent and easy to train, making them great companions for both individuals and families.

Norwegian Buhund

The Norwegian Buhund is a medium-sized breed that hails from Norway. They are known for their friendly and energetic personalities, as well as their striking appearance with a thick, weather-resistant coat and pointed ears. Buhunds are known for their loyalty and agility, making them great working dogs as well as loving family pets.

Caring for a Yorkie-Buhund Mix

Like all dogs, the Yorkshire Terrier with Norwegian Buhund mix requires regular grooming and exercise to maintain their health and happiness. Their fluffy coat will need to be brushed regularly to prevent matting, and they will also benefit from daily walks and playtime to keep them mentally and physically stimulated. In addition, they will need a nutritious diet and regular visits to the veterinarian to ensure they stay in good health.
